DIVAN OF OBEYD ZAKANI Translation and Introduction Paul Smith Obeyd Zakani (b. 1300) is an important a figure in Persian and Sufi literature and poetry. His satire, humorous stories, ribald and obscene poems, social commentary, mystical ghazals, prose, ruba'is, qit'as and his famous epic qasida 'Cat & Mouse' are popular today and are more relevant than ever. He is considered to be one of the world's greatest satirist and social-commentator whose life and mystical poems had a great influence on his student and friend Hafiz and many others. This is the largest selection of his works available in English. The correct rhyme-structure has been kept as well as the beauty and meaning of these sometimes rude, funny and mystical poems and prose. There is a long Introduction on his Life, Times & Works.
